Being transgender is not a mental illness, and the WHO should acknowledge this

  • Written by Damien Riggs, Associate Professor in Social Work, Australian Research Council Future Fellow, Flinders University
imageThe pathology lies in society discriminating against transgender people, not in transgender people themselves.Ted Eytan/Flickr, CC BY

The World Health Organisation (WHO) has announced it may no longer classify being transgender as a disorder in the revised version of its International Classification of Diseases (ICD), due for release in 2018.
